Why a Fish Tank Water Pump Is Necessary

From my experience, a fish tank water pump is absolutely essential for maintaining a healthy aquarium. I’ve found that without proper water circulation, the tank water quickly becomes stagnant, which can harm my fish and promote the growth of harmful bacteria and algae. The pump helps keep the water moving, ensuring oxygen gets evenly distributed throughout the tank, which is vital for my fish to breathe and thrive.

Additionally, the water pump works hand-in-hand with my filtration system. It pushes water through the filter media, removing debris and toxins that accumulate over time. Without this circulation, waste builds up and water quality deteriorates, which I’ve learned can lead to stress or disease in fish. Overall, having a reliable water pump gives me peace of mind that my aquatic environment stays clean, healthy, and balanced.

My Buying Guide on ‘Fish Tank Water Pump’

When I first started setting up my aquarium, I quickly realized how important a good fish tank water pump is for keeping my aquatic friends healthy and happy. Over time, I’ve learned what features matter most and how to choose the right pump for my tank. Here’s what I’ve found helpful in my own experience.

1. Understanding the Purpose of a Fish Tank Water Pump

For me, the water pump isn’t just about moving water — it plays a vital role in oxygenating the tank, maintaining water circulation, and supporting filtration systems. Without proper water movement, my fish tank became stagnant, which led to unhealthy water conditions.

2. Tank Size and Flow Rate

One of the first things I considered was the size of my aquarium. The pump’s flow rate, usually measured in gallons per hour (GPH), needs to match the tank’s volume. A good rule of thumb I follow is choosing a pump that can circulate the entire tank water 4 to 5 times per hour. For example, for a 20-gallon tank, a pump with a flow rate of around 80 to 100 GPH works well for me.

3. Noise Level

Since I keep my aquarium in my living room, I wanted a pump that runs quietly. Some models can be noisy or produce vibrations that can be disturbing. I always check s focusing on noise level before making a purchase, and I look for pumps labeled as “quiet” or “whisper-quiet.”

4. Energy Efficiency

I run my pump 24/7, so energy consumption is something I pay attention to. Some pumps consume more electricity, which can add up over time. I prefer energy-efficient models that keep the tank healthy without hiking my electric bill.

5. Adjustable Flow Rate

Being able to adjust the flow rate is a feature I appreciate. Sometimes my tank’s inhabitants prefer gentler water movement, especially delicate fish or plants. A pump with adjustable speed lets me customize the flow to suit my tank’s needs.

6. Durability and Build Quality

I look for pumps made with corrosion-resistant materials since they’re submerged in water constantly. A sturdy build means the pump will last longer without frequent replacements. Brands with good warranties also give me peace of mind.

7. Ease of Installation and Maintenance

I prefer pumps that are easy to install and clean. Some models come with simple suction cups or brackets that keep the pump securely in place. Also, being able to easily disassemble the pump for cleaning helps me maintain optimal performance.

8. Additional Features

Over time, I noticed some pumps come with useful extras like built-in filtration, integrated heaters, or compatibility with timers and controllers. While not always necessary, these features can add convenience depending on your setup.

9. Budget Considerations

I found that while it’s tempting to go for the cheapest option, investing a bit more in a reliable and efficient pump pays off. It prevents future headaches like pump failure or unhealthy tank conditions.
